离散成 的方法存在很多,但是各个方法直接存在优劣,从两方面进行参数比较:
方面:
1、从零点和极点;
2、环节的频率响应(幅频和相频特性);
系统控制方面,评价离散方法的参数:1、主导零、极点;2、系统带宽或者穿越频率;3、直流增益;4、增益裕度;5、相位裕度;6、超调量;7、闭环频率特性的峰值
常见的离散化方法:
1、脉冲响应不变法;
2、加零阶保持器的脉冲响应不变法;
3、差分变换法;
4、双线性变换;
5、频率预畸变双线性变换法;
6、极点零点对应法;
脉冲响应不变法
脉冲响应不变法:使设计出来的 其单位脉冲响应 与 的单位脉冲响应 的采样值相等。最具代表性的就是理想采样过程;
脉冲响应不变法实质上就是z变换法,因此s平面与z平面的映射关系上基于 ,s平面的左半平面映射到单位圆内,s平面的虚轴映射到圆周。
s平面与z平面不是一一对应关系,s平面沿着虚轴 移到 ,对应于z平面上上沿着圆周转过一圈,当 的最高频带超过 ,z变换以后会产生频率混叠现象。
加零阶保持器的脉冲响应不变法
零阶保持器把前一采样时刻 的采样值 一直保持到下一采样时刻 到来之前,使得信号变成一个个类似阶梯的信号。
零阶保持器数学表达式:
零阶保持器给定一个理想脉冲 ,其脉冲过度函数 。对其进行拉氏变换后得到的传递函数:
当在s平面的虚轴时:
所以,通过上式来看,零阶保持器具有低通滤波器特性(相角滞后、时间滞后、稳定裕度要差些)。
保持器用于将离散信号变换成连续模拟信号,当零阶保持器加入 再离散,虽然采用脉冲响应不变法,但等效 输入的是连续模拟信号,因此比单纯使用脉冲响应不变法离散 更接近连续系统。此方法实质上就是z变换法。最具代表性的就是实际采样过程。
差分变换法
应用泰勒公式得到差分变换法等效式:
泰勒公式:
保留到一次差分项 :
后向差分法
后向差分的近似式:
等式左边的拉氏变换为:
等式右边取z变换为:
所以,s和z域的对应关系为 , ,
z域到s域的对应关系
1、s平面的虚轴在z域的映射关系:
那么,等式的虚部和实部分别为:
可以通过虚部和实部的等式等效出 关于圆的方程,其中圆心在 ,半径为 。于是s平面的虚轴映射到z轴上一个半径为 的圆。
2、s平面左半平面( )在z域的映射关系:
对应的取值 ,当 时候,会映射到单位圆内。当 取值很大的时候,会被唯一映射到半径 的圆上。不会出现频率混叠现象,但是会出现频率被压缩的情况。
最常用的离散方法
前向差分法
后向差分的近似式:
所以,s和z域的对应关系为 ,
z域到s域的对应关系
1、s平面的虚轴在z域的映射关系: ,说明s平面的虚轴映射到z平面是一条过实轴1平行与虚轴的直线;
2、s平面左半平面( )在z域的映射关系: ,那么 ,当 时候,要使得 取值合适才可以在单位圆内部。
所以,这种办法可能会出现不稳定的映射。
双线性变换
1、应用梯形面积逼近积分得到双线性变换等效式:
定积分:
等式两边的拉氏变换为:
积分传递函数
使用梯形面积进行数值积分计算: ,进行z变换得到:
积分z的传递函数:
z域到s域的对应关系 或者
2、应用泰勒公式得到双线性变换等效式:
泰勒公式:
保留到一次差分项 : ,进而得到
1、s平面的虚轴在z域的映射关系:
从上述的等式可以看出来 时, ;当 时, ;当 时, 。说明 从 时,z的相角由 ,幅度一直为1。所以,s域的虚轴唯一映射到z平面的单位圆上。
2、s平面左半平面( )在z域的映射关系:
那么 ,当 的时候,在z域的映射在单位圆内。
推荐使用双线性变换方法;
频率预畸变双线性变换法
经过双线性变换后,模拟频率 和离散频率 之间存在频率畸变现象,使用 和 代入
所以, 和离散频率 之間的非线性关系式: ,也限制了双线性变换法的使用。
如果系统要求变换后的某些特定频率不能畸变时,可以采用上述公式进行补偿。
分三个步骤:
-
将期望零极点 使用 代替
-
将 变换为
-
调整增益;频率预畸变会导致系统零极点移动,导致系统增益发生变化,所以对增益进行调整,保证前后增益相同
OC](这里写自定义目录标题)
欢迎使用Markdown编辑器
你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。
新的改变
我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,帮助你用它写博客:
- 全新的界面设计 ,将会带来全新的写作体验;
- 在创作中心设置你喜爱的代码高亮样式,Markdown 将代码片显示选择的高亮样式 进行展示;
- 增加了 图片拖拽 功能,你可以将本地的图片直接拖拽到编辑区域直接展示;
- 全新的 KaTeX数学公式 语法;
- 增加了支持甘特图的mermaid语法1 功能;
- 增加了 多屏幕编辑 Markdown文章功能;
- 增加了 焦点写作模式、预览模式、简洁写作模式、左右区域同步滚轮设置 等功能,功能按钮位于编辑区域与预览区域中间;
- 增加了 检查列表 功能。
功能快捷键
撤销:Ctrl/Command + Z
重做:Ctrl/Command + Y
加粗:Ctrl/Command + B
斜体:Ctrl/Command + I
标题:Ctrl/Command + Shift + H
无序列表:Ctrl/Command + Shift + U
有序列表:Ctrl/Command + Shift + O
检查列表:Ctrl/Command + Shift + C
插入代码:Ctrl/Command + Shift + K
插入链接:Ctrl/Command + Shift + L
插入图片:Ctrl/Command + Shift + G
合理的创建标题,有助于目录的生成
直接输入1次#,并按下space后,将生成1级标题。
输入2次#,并按下space后,将生成2级标题。
以此类推,我们支持6级标题。有助于使用TOC
语法后生成一个完美的目录。
如何改变文本的样式
强调文本 强调文本
加粗文本 加粗文本
标记文本
删除文本
引用文本
H2O is是液体。
210 运算结果是 1024.
插入链接与图片
链接: link.
图片:
带尺寸的图片:
当然,我们为了让用户更加便捷,我们增加了图片拖拽功能。
如何插入一段漂亮的代码片
去博客设置页面,选择一款你喜欢的代码片高亮样式,下面展示同样高亮的 代码片
.
// An highlighted block
var foo = 'bar';
生成一个适合你的列表
- 项目
- 项目
- 项目
- 项目
- 项目1
- 项目2
- 项目3
- 计划任务
- 完成任务
创建一个表格
一个简单的表格是这么创建的:
项目 | Value |
---|---|
电脑 | $1600 |
手机 | $12 |
导管 | $1 |
设定内容居中、居左、居右
使用:---------:
居中
使用:----------
居左
使用----------:
居右
第一列 | 第二列 | 第三列 |
---|---|---|
第一列文本居中 | 第二列文 |